 January 22 by TinSparrow (6184 found)
A few years back when I was living in Florida, I found myself on a business trip where it would be possible for me to visit Mingo. I made sure that I built enough time in that trip to do that, and I made the necessary pilgrimage to that cache. Sometime later I noticed that Kansas Stasher still had one more active cache, and I thought that it would be fun to find that one as well. Today (on my birthday) I took the day off and embarked on a road trip from Colorado Springs and ventured to this cache and others in the area. While Mingo is a great cache to find for historical reasons, Arikaree is by far my favorite cache of the two. I love being led well off the beaten path to find this very scenic corner of Kansas, and the winter landscape with its yellow and brown colors was stunning. I took some pictures and I'll post them, but I hardly think that they'll do justice to my experience there today. Thanks for luring me way out here to this great location.
